Bible Verses for O Come, O Come, Emmanuel
O Come, O Come, Emmanuel is an advent song that has been around for a long time. It is based on the O Antiphons that go back to at least the eighth century. The later version, O Come, O Come, Emmanuel, is believed to date back to the twelfth century, though it was published in 1710 in Psalteriolum Cantionum Catholicarum in Latin. Additional stanzas (Wisdom and Desire of Nations) were added in 1878.
The major English translations were written by John Mason Neale in 1851 and later revised in 1861. The revision changed "Draw nigh, draw nigh, Emmanuel" to "O come, O come, Emmanuel." In 1906, Thomas Alexander Lacey also translated the text. The additional verses were translated by Henry Sloane Coffin in 1916.

Bible Verses for All Creatures of Our God and King
All Creatures of Our God and King is an English translation of a medieval poem. The original poem Canticle of the Sun by Francis of Assisi was written in Latin around 1225. It was translated by William H. Draper and first published in 1919.
This beautifully worded hymn poetically describes all of Creation praising God. I'm not sure why this song makes me think of Thanksgiving, but I'm not alone in labeling it so. I imagine it is the image of creation praising Him during this season when nature is so strongly the focus with the harvesting of crops and the changing colors of leaves. And for those who might not know, Alleluia (or Hallelujah) means "Praise the Lord"
